Hi,

I've been lurking on the list for a few weeks now and I thought I should

introduce myself. I am a US soldier stationed in Okinawa, Japan and I play
Warhammer 40K, Full Thrust and now Dirtside II. I've been playing Full Thrust
for about 2 years now, when I PCS'd to Japan I was playing Battlefleet Gothic.
When some of the other guys in the local gaming club introduced me to Full
Thrust I switched over instantly (I used to hate the
fact escorts died in 1-2 hits, plus having a design system for custom
ships rocks!) Lately I've been getting agrevated more and more with GW over
their codex creep. I'm an Ork player, so no shiny toys (or new codex) for me,
not
that I care I still win over half my games (Choppas rule, ;-)).  So I
downloaded the Dirtside II rules and played the first scenario in the back.
This was after scouring the net for cardstock buildings and vehicles to print
and assemble. I must say once you run through a couple of turns the game is
faster than 40K, I like the chits and markers system. I got my first few
models from GZG monday and finished up a few last night. Once I get my
infantry painted I'll play another game and take some photos. I'll be running
a demo game this weekend for my gaming group and hopefully I can get some
other interested. Personally, I think the smaller scale will draw some
interest as fire & maneuver plays a bigger part in 6mm scale than 28mm
(40K).
